package org.httpkit.client; import javax.net.ssl.HttpsURLConnection; import javax.net.ssl.SSLPeerUnverifiedException; import java.io.BufferedReader; import java.io.IOException; import java.io.InputStreamReader; import java.net.URL; import java.security.cert.Certificate; public class HttpsTest { public static void main(String[] args) throws IOException { HttpsURLConnection con = (HttpsURLConnection) new URL("https://github.com").openConnection(); print_https_cert(con); //dump all the content print_content(con); } private static void print_content(HttpsURLConnection con) { if (con != null) { try { System.out.println("****** Content of the URL ********"); BufferedReader br = new BufferedReader( new InputStreamReader(con.getInputStream())); String input; while ((input = br.readLine()) != null) { System.out.println(input); } br.close(); } catch (IOException e) { e.printStackTrace(); } } } private static void print_https_cert(HttpsURLConnection con) { if (con != null) { try { System.out.println("Response Code : " + con.getResponseCode()); System.out.println("Cipher Suite : " + con.getCipherSuite()); System.out.println("\n"); Certificate[] certs = con.getServerCertificates(); for (Certificate cert : certs) { System.out.println("Cert Type : " + cert.getType()); System.out.println("Cert Hash Code : " + cert.hashCode()); System.out.println("Cert Public Key Algorithm : " + cert.getPublicKey().getAlgorithm()); System.out.println("Cert Public Key Format : " + cert.getPublicKey().getFormat()); System.out.println("\n"); } } catch (SSLPeerUnverifiedException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} } } }
